The Great Debasement Trade: Protecting Your Portfolio in Uncertain Times (2025)

The ongoing discussion about the potential debasement of currencies is sending shockwaves through financial markets worldwide.

As of October 13, 2025, at 11:30 PM UTC, while the day-to-day fluctuations of the markets capture immediate attention, a more significant shift may be occurring beneath these superficial changes. Investors are becoming increasingly concerned about soaring budget deficits, prompting a re-evaluation of various assets in an effort to safeguard their investments.

Amidst the backdrop of renewed tensions between the United States and China over tariffs—an issue that grabbed headlines and pushed many traders away from riskier investments to safer options like bonds—money managers have been focusing on what’s being termed the "debasement trade."
